Tapered Journal Repair on Large RollThe bearing journal on this large roll used for Paper Making was mis-machined undersized. The journal was thermal sprayed with Carbon Steel using the Wire Combustion Process. Our machinist used a Sine Bar Gauge during finish machining to meet the tapered bearing specification. ASB's customer requested expedited processing for a planned outage. Shown is the newly engineered KINETIKS® 2000 High Pressure Cold Spray System from CGT Cold Gas Technology GmbH. The hand held Gun compliments the wide range of high pressure Cold Spray equipment available from CGT. The innovative CGT 2000® System is capable of reaching expansion gas temperature to 300º C with up to 20 bar (300psi) pressures. CGT-Cold Gas Technology GmbH in Ampfing, Germany worked closely with ASB Industries on concept development. All CGT equipment offers advanced technology systems that give users production quality Cold Spray surfacing for a variety of new and practical applications complimenting Thermal Spray Surfacing technologies.
